Synopsis "Graveyard Shore"

As his on-again/off-again girlfriend likes to say, Tom Edge has moved from one graveyard to another- from the Graveyard of the Pacific as a US Coast Guard Intelligence Service officer, to the Graveyard of the Atlantic as sheriff. He's traded a long and storied career with the USCG IS for the life of a sheriff in a coastal North Carolina county that's half underwater, with a population that grows exponentially during the Outer Banks tourist season, and boasts a beach for a highway. The protected-by-law wild horses living in the dunes and trotting up and down that road with immunity have been here since the time of the Spanish Conquistadores. Edge has been here only a year or two and already it seems like a lifetime. Tom Edge is used to things washing up on the beach. Everything from driftwood, to trash, to seaweed, to flotsam from the countless ships washed up on county shores. There's even the unfortunate drowning now and again. So he's not terribly surprised to hear that a dead body has landed on his beach. But this corpse turns out to have been the victim of foul play. That changes everything. The victim was a motel manager with a sketchy past, including a history of a minor run in or two with the law, and a not-so-grieving widow. Altogether a fairly unremarkable man. Except for his death. Edge's team includes a by-the-book second-in-command, a sharp and foul-mouthed captain who thinks she can manhandle the world into submission, and a French-speaking assistant who can't seem to get Edge's job title straight. This former Coast Guard man may have come to the Carolina coast to escape his past and his own personal demons, but he is about to learn that solving this murder just might push him over the edge.
